CPG Launch Leaders ranks #3326 on The B2B Podcast Index with a substance score of 60.0 out of 100, scored across 1 recent episode. It scores highest on guest caliber and insight density. There are a handful of genuinely useful tactical tips buried in the episode - notably the August - October window for holiday gift guide filing and the advice to pre-approve seasonal messaging templates so large brands can respond quickly - but the episode is padded with platitudes and the guest often restates the obvious rather than building on useful points.
“they're filing stories, especially if it's related to like holiday gift guides, they're filing those stories anytime between August and October”
“Do not just ship your product willy nilly to influencers and hope that that turns into something”
The episode recycles well-worn PR 101 advice - start early, build journalist relationships, PR takes time - with only one mildly fresh angle: treating journalists-as-influencers like freelance writers who can be a gateway to multiple publications. No contrarian or first-principles thinking surfaces.
“many journalists are also influencers themselves. And so we think about influencers in a very similar way that we do freelance writers”

The episode includes some named examples (US Potato Board, Chelsea Market pop-up, a curly-hair accessories client, Self Healthy Beauty Awards) and one useful concrete heuristic (two-year minimum engagement), but no campaign metrics, revenue figures, coverage counts, or ROI data appear anywhere.
“she actually just won two self healthy beauty awards”
“the best brands that we've worked with in terms of getting media coverage, we've been working with for at least two years”
The host leans heavily on affirmation ('That's amazing,' 'Absolutely,' repeating back what the guest just said) and rarely probes for depth or pushes back on vague claims; questions are broad and open-ended rather than sharp or challenging, resulting in a cordial but largely uncritical PR interview.
